You really have to see it to believe it! Orlando's Ripley's Believe it or not Odditorium is housed in a mansion that appears to be sinking into a famous everglade sinkhole! But don't worry – once inside, you can safely explore what Ripley has to offer. Each Ripley's offers a collection 90% different than any other, so you're assured of a great time no matter how many other odditoriums you may have visited. One of the unique Orlando Odditorium's features is a massive portrait of Van Gogh – created by a collage of over 3,000 smaller Van Gogh postcards! Or, for those who can stomach it, check out the South American shrunken head! This head was sent to Ripley by a South American fan with the note: "Please take good care of this. I think it is one of my relatives!"

Another star attraction is the Matchstick "Silver Ghost" Rolls Royce. This car was built entirely out of glue and matchsticks – 1,016,711 of them! And it even has moving parts, wheels that turn, and working headlights!

The average odditorium visit lasts about two hours, and is a self-guided experience. The museum is located at 8201 International Drive, Orlando, Florida. Believe it or not, you're note going to want to leave this zany world of oddities!

The Orlando Odditorium appears to be sinking into one of Florida's infamous sinkholes. For over 40 years, Robert Ripley-- the modern Marco Polo and the real-life Indiana Jones-- traveled the world collecting the unbelievable, the inexplicable, the one-of-a-kind. All of it amazing and much of it extremely amusing.
